607179: CVE-2012-3359 CVE-2013-7347 conga: insecure handling of luci web interface sessions
It was discovered that luci stored usernames and passwords in session cookies. This issue prevented the session inactivity timeout feature from working correctly, and allowed attackers able to get access to a session cookie to obtain the victim's authentication credentials.
